More about child psychologist courses in Geelong

If you are looking to pursue a rewarding career as a Child Psychologist in Geelong, you will find a selection of comprehensive Child Psychologist courses in Geelong tailored for experienced learners. These courses are designed to equip you with the skills and knowledge necessary to excel in the field of child psychology. Notably, the Bachelor of Arts (Psychology) and the Bachelor of Psychology (Honours) (Child and Family) programs stand out as popular choices for those wanting to deepen their understanding and expertise in child psychology.

Finding the right training provider is crucial, and all courses within this sector are offered by Registered Training Organisations (RTOs) or recognized industry bodies, ensuring a high-quality education. Geelong, with its growing demand for mental health professionals, provides a conducive environment for aspiring Child Psychologists. Understanding how to become a Child Psychologist is just the beginning; these courses will prepare you for various career paths in related job roles as well.

Upon completion of your studies, you may wish to explore various career opportunities such as becoming a Community Development Manager, a Student Counsellor, or a Family Support Worker. Other potential job roles include Mental Health Worker, Child Safety Officer, and even a Residential Care Worker. These roles are vital for supporting children and families in the Geelong community.

Additionally, the skills gained from Child Psychologist courses in Geelong will enable you to work as a Substance Abuse Counsellor, a Social Worker, or a Youth Support Worker. With such a broad spectrum of career paths available, students can tailor their education to better fit their ambitions while contributing positively to the well-being of children and families in Geelong.
